Description:At Lockheed Martin, we apply our passion for purposeful
innovation to keep people safe and solve the world's most complex
challenges. We are seeking a talented engineer who enjoys holistic
system thinking to support system design and requirements (SDR)
through the architecture, development, integration and verification
activities. This role will require onsite support full-time at
Lockheed Martin's Missiles and Fire Control facility in Dallas, TX
working a 4/10 Flex schedule. This position requires a DoD Secret
clearance, therefore, U.S. citizenship is required.
The candidate must be knowledgeable in core Systems Engineering
disciplines such as Mission Analysis, Requirements Analysis, and
functional and physical System Architecture development. The
candidate must be proficient with System Engineering tools (DOORS,
Microsoft Word/Excel, CAMEO). Candidate must possess strong
leadership and interpersonal skills, effective task organization
and communication skills.

Basic Qualifications:
- Strong / Demonstrated Systems Engineering skills
- Experience developing models in both SysML and UAF
environments
- Experience with previous system design of a product through
various program phases
- Hands on experience with systems design tools DOORS and either
Cameo or Rhapsody
- Familiarity with the PDP and Systems Engineering EPMs, and a
mastery of the systems engineering "why" behind the steps
- Ability to lead/coach a team of architects through a modeling
effort
-This position requires a DoD Secret clearance, therefore, U.S.
citizenship is required.
Desired Skills:
Experience with writing effective white papers to describe
potential architectures and shape stakeholder views is desired.
Experience with requirements verification methods and test planning
is desired
